By the present Writ Petition, the petitioner question the rejection of her candidature to the post of Tutor at the hands of Goa Public Service Commission (GPSC), the respondent No.2 to the petition. She seek a declaration that she is qualified to be selected to the post of Tutor in terms of the advertisement issued by the GPSC inviting applications for the said post.

(3.) On 08.05.2020, the GPSC issued advertisement no.4/2020 inviting applications for distinct post enumerated therein. This included the post within the purview of Director of Health Services and applications for the post of Tutor in the Institute of Nursing Education were also invited. 19 posts of Tutor came to be advertised which covered 2 posts reserved for schedule tribes, 5 posts reserved for other backward classes and remaining 12 posts to be filled in from open category.
